The Cherry Mobile Flare J2 is a follow-up of the popular Flare J1 introduced late last year. Comparing the specs of these 2, I’m sure users would prefer the improved specs of the Flare J2. Aside from the OS, the internal storage, RAM and cameras were updated as well as the display which is now on HD. Just like the Flare J1, the Flare J2 is a solid device to hold.
Here are the Cherry Mobile Flare J2 Specs:
OS: | Android 6.0 Marshmallow |
---|---|
Processor: | 1.3 GHz MTK6580 Quad-Core processor | MALI 400 MP |
Display: | 720 x 1280 5" HD IPS Display |
Wireless Connections: | Bluetooth 4.0, WiFi b/g/n, GPS, A-GPS |
Memory: | 8 GB Internal Storage expandable with a Micro SD card up to 64GB, 1GB RAM |
Connectors: | Micro USB |
Cameras: | 13 Megapixels (Main Camera), 5 Megapixels (Front) |
SIM Card Slots: | 2x Micro SIM Cards required |
Battery: | 2,000 mAh |
SRP: | P2,999 |
The Cherry Mobile Flare J2 price is P2,999 which should be one of the most affordable smartphones with Android Marshmallow OS. It is now available at all Cherry Mobile stores and kiosks.
